QSAS_2_4/QSAS_dist/src/Arithmetic/qar/qar.h File Reference

#include <iostream>
#include <cstddef>
#include <cstdio>
#include <cstdlib>
#include <string>
#include <cmath>
#include <cctype>
#include "Qdos.h"
#include "qdutil.h"
#include "qplug_if.h"
#include "qunit_if.h"

Defines

#define QAR_OK   QDUTIL_OK
#define QAR_ERR   QDUTIL_ERR
#define QAR_WARN   QDUTIL_WARN

Functions

QdObject_var QarConvertUnitsTo (QdObject_var ptr, const char *SIcTarget, const char *newUnits="")
double QarConvFactor (const char *SIc)
double Qar_atof (const char *vtxt)
bool QarSameBaseSI (const char *SIc1, const char *SIc2)
int QarTestConformal (QdObject_var in1_ptr, QdObject_var in2_ptr)
int QarTestConformalForVecProds (QdObject_var in1_ptr, QdObject_var in2_ptr)
int QarTestJoined (QdObject_var do1, QdObject_var do2)
int QarAreUnitsSame (QdObject_var ptr1, QdObject_var ptr2)
int QarAreFramesSame (QdObject_var ptr1, QdObject_var ptr2)
char * QarSIConv_product (QdObject_var in1_var, QdObject_var in2_var)
char * QarSIConv_inverse (QdObject_var in_var)
char * QarSIConv_power (QdObject_var in_var, double constB)
char * QarFrame_product (QdObject_var in1_var, QdObject_var in2_var)
char * QarUNITS_product (QdObject_var in1_var, QdObject_var in2_var)
char * QarUNITS_power (QdObject_var in_var, double constB)
int QarHasUnits (QdObject_var in_var)

Define Documentation

#define QAR_ERR   QDUTIL_ERR

#define QAR_OK   QDUTIL_OK

#define QAR_WARN   QDUTIL_WARN


Function Documentation

double Qar_atof ( const char *  vtxt  ) 

int QarAreFramesSame ( QdObject_var  ptr1,
QdObject_var  ptr2 
)

int QarAreUnitsSame ( QdObject_var  ptr1,
QdObject_var  ptr2 
)

QdObject_var QarConvertUnitsTo ( QdObject_var  ptr,
const char *  SIcTarget,
const char *  newUnits = "" 
)

double QarConvFactor ( const char *  SIc  ) 

char* QarFrame_product ( QdObject_var  in1_var,
QdObject_var  in2_var 
)

int QarHasUnits ( QdObject_var  in_var  ) 

bool QarSameBaseSI ( const char *  SIc1,
const char *  SIc2 
)

char* QarSIConv_inverse ( QdObject_var  in_var  ) 

char* QarSIConv_power ( QdObject_var  in_var,
double  constB 
)

char* QarSIConv_product ( QdObject_var  in1_var,
QdObject_var  in2_var 
)

int QarTestConformal ( QdObject_var  in1_ptr,
QdObject_var  in2_ptr 
)

int QarTestConformalForVecProds ( QdObject_var  in1_ptr,
QdObject_var  in2_ptr 
)

int QarTestJoined ( QdObject_var  do1,
QdObject_var  do2 
)

char* QarUNITS_power ( QdObject_var  in_var,
double  constB 
)

char* QarUNITS_product ( QdObject_var  in1_var,
QdObject_var  in2_var 
)


Generated on Fri Jan 8 12:51:21 2010 for QSAS by  doxygen 1.5.7